随着互联网技术的飞速发展,Java作为一门成熟的编程语言,在各个行业中都扮演着重要的角色。而在Java技术栈中,TSVB(Tomcat、Spring、SpringMVC、MyBatis)组合一直是开发...
一、什么是集合工厂?在Java编程中,集合工厂(CollectionFactory)是一种常用的设计模式,用于创建和管理集合对象。它通过提供一系列工厂方法,让开发者能够轻松地创建不同类型的集合对象,如...
一、引言在Java开发过程中,我们经常会遇到各种网络问题。这时候,一款强大的工具——netstat就显得尤为重要。netstat是Linux和Windows系统下常用的网络分析工具,可以用来查看系统当...
一、引言在Java微服务架构中,系统稳定性和性能优化成为了开发者和运维人员关注的焦点。而Sentinel系统规则作为一种强大的流量控制框架,能够在保证系统稳定性的同时,提高系统的吞吐量和资源利用率。本...
在Java行业,知识管理是一个至关重要的环节。随着技术的不断更新迭代,如何有效地管理和利用知识,对于企业来说,既是挑战也是机遇。本文将从实际经验出发,深入分析Java行业知识管理的要点,探讨如何打造高...
在Java应用开发中,缓存是一个提高性能、减少数据库压力的重要手段。然而,缓存数据如果不及时清理,可能会导致内存泄漏、响应速度下降等问题。本文将深入探讨Java缓存清理的实战技巧与案例分析,帮助开发者...
一、引言在互联网时代,数据已经成为企业竞争的重要资源。网页数据作为数据来源之一,其价值不言而喻。而HTML作为网页数据的基本格式,其内容提取对于数据分析、爬虫开发等任务至关重要。Jsoup,这个基于J...
一、MyBatis简介MyBatis是一个优秀的持久层框架,它支持定制化SQL、存储过程以及高级映射。MyBatis避免了几乎所有的JDBC代码和手动设置参数以及获取结果集的工作。MyBatis使用简...
Java和Go都是当今最受欢迎的编程语言之一,它们在各自的领域都有着广泛的应用。对于从事Java开发的程序员来说,是否考虑转向Go语言,成为了一个值得探讨的话题。本文将从实际应用、性能、社区支持等方面...
在Java行业,告警抑制是一个至关重要的概念。它不仅关系到系统的稳定性和可靠性,还直接影响到运维团队的效率和压力。作为一名拥有10年经验的资深站长和SEO专家,我深知告警抑制在Java运维中的重要性。...